countries default on sovereign debt roughly 2-3 times per century on average, based on historical records for nations like spain (13 defaults 1500-1900) and france (8 from 1500-1800), though it varies by region and era—emerging markets see more.
over 100 years, the probability is very high, often near 100% for at-risk countries, as crises recur cyclically despite adaptations.
